No model of car can be 'CHAV'
I've been thinking about these accusations that the Impreza has become a 'chav' car. One model of car can only be classed as chav if a majority are owned by chavs. The price of a new WRX is around £20k, that's out of reach of your average chav even after a discount. Three to five year old second hand WRXs should cost at least £9k unless they are near write-offs. That's too expensive for chavs as well. So we are talking about some early scoobies that probably need some work done. This is hardly a majority.
Calling every Impreza on the road chav because some chavs can now afford to buy them is like saying a baby born to a council estate family is automatically chav. Like some cars, they become chav as they get older.

But have you seen what gets done to the newer more expensive Subarus?...the owner may not come from a chav culture...but some certainly employ what is seen as chav tastes.
The problem is the word "chav" has now become a widespread branding to what was once used to depict scum, and is now used to describe someones tastes in style amongst other things. The slang word has lost its meaning. Which is why I prefer to resort to more specific words.
